Default Broken Rod, whats necessary?

98 XJ 4.0 125K miles. I recently broke a connecting rod. I sucked up some water a few months back and I believe that is when the damage started. I have the head and manifolds off, the block is still in the jeep. I was able to just push the piston out of the cylinder from underneath. the cylinder is in good shape, a couple scratches at the very bottom that a stone/hone would take out. Head/valves seem to be fine. Rod bearings look good, journal looks good. Piston is cracked, rod was bent and broken. How far should i take this? get a JY piston/rod and throw it in? or should I take the engine out and rebuild it? I've gotten this far, and my gut tells me to go all the way. Am I Wasting time and $ rebuilding? DD weekend warrior. Thanks.
